Far more than just an ornament, the Vitra Eames House Bird is a miniature marvel that embodies the spirit of design and whimsy. Introduced in 1951 by Charles and Ray Eames, this creation has become a beloved symbol of their playful and innovative approach.
This charming wooden bird originated from a collection of folk art and objects the Eames couple gathered during their travels. Inspired by the simple elegance of a traditional toy bird, they reimagined it for their California home, where it became a cherished centerpiece.
Both versions feature a solid wood body for sturdiness and a steel wire base for stability, ensuring this feathered friend remains perched for years to come.
